Tyson Foods to close Eagle Mountain plant, impacting more than 700 Utah workers

Tyson Foods is closing two beef facilities and seeking a buyer for a third due to a historic shortage of cattle. The closures impact over 3,000 employees across multiple states. In Utah, the Eagle Mountain plant is shutting down, resulting in 723 job losses. In Illinois, the closure of the Joslin facility will leave 2,500 people jobless. Additionally, the company is pursuing the sale of its plant in the Tri-Cities area of Washington state as the beef market struggles.

    Why it matters

    Tyson expanded into Utah five years ago before these recent layoffs. The current industry struggle stems from a critical lack of cattle supply. These moves signal a broader contraction of Tyson's beef processing footprint.
